The KNA SG-1 is a handcrafted, bridge-mounted piezo pickup designed for steel-string acoustic guitars. It delivers natural sound reproduction with a lightweight wood sensor, installs easily without modifications, and operates passively without batteries. Like most guitarists I've spent too much time and $$ on the elusive shibboleth of Acoustic Tone. Pickup designer Lloyd Baggs once said that though it's often maligned, the undersaddle piezo pickup has been and remains the true go-to workhorse for live music since the 70s. This particular piezo pickup is mounted between the saddle and pins on top of the bridge and it's brilliant and simple. Why didn't anyone think of this before? I use the KNA SG-1 on my Travel-Air VAMD40 travel guitar, the one with the folding neck. It's easy to install with a folding neck -- no loosening or tightening strings. In terms of size, the fingernail file-sized stick plugs in with an unobtrusive, detachable 1/8" cable (included). The other side of the approximately 8' cable has a standard 1/4" jack for a guitar amp or mixer. I really like the fact that the cable is detachable. Very nice glossy finish on the jack's treble side. My only suggestion would be offering it in ebony black in addition to natural wood. Also, I strum aggressively so a right angle away from the sound hole, though it would probably be a bit unsightly, would help me from occasionally brushing my hand up against the pickup. The sound is natural and perfectly balanced. One tip: try turning your eq all the way up and then subtracting to taste. The reason for this is that any potentiometers (knobs) are by nature tone sucks, so this passive pickup to me sounds fullest and richest with all knobs at or near 10. I'm sold! Update 5/9/2019. This is a really good pick up. The concern that most buyers expressed was that it was fragile. The tone quality is really good , very clean. In the instructions, there is a drawing, of attaching a cable protector to One’s belt or clothing. I think this is not a good idea. I decided to attach the belt clip to the guitar with double stick tape (photo uploaded). This will hopefully insulate the very thin wooden pickup from an inadvertent pull that could break it. To me, this is a much better solution and clipping the belt to some part of my body.
